Frequently Asked Questions
How can I calculate the coffee extraction ratio?
Divide the total liquid yield magnitude (grams) by the total grain dose magnitude (grams). A professional espresso audit targets a 1:2 reconciliation (e.g., 18g dose to 36g yield). Pourover synthesis targets a 1:15 to 1:17 reconciliation.
What is the "Extraction Yield" (%) reconciliation?
Extraction yield is the magnitude of coffee solids units dissolved into the liquid. A professional audit targets 18.0% to 22.0% reconciliation. Magnitudes below this prerequisite reconcile into "Underextraction" noise (sour profiles).
Does grind size affect the coffee audit?
Yes. Grind size magnitude is the primary variable in "Surface Area" reconciliation. Finer magnitudes increase the extraction speed magnitude, a prerequisite for espresso synthesis homeostasis.
How can I convert coffee scoops to water volume?
Generally, 1 scoop (approx. 7g) reconciles to 120ml (4oz) of water for a 1:17 magnitude. Precision dose reconciliation (using mass units) is the prerequisite for consistency.
What is a "TDS" audit in coffee?
Total Dissolved Solids (TDS) is the magnitude of coffee strength. A professional audit targets 1.15% to 1.35% TDS for brewed coffee units. This reconciliation is the clinical prerequisite for balanced flavor profile synthesis.
